Output 86cdf91ec79c820b7a3e41988c01507591509e9c835472245a96fc9ed428943c:59

value
10784592
script pubkey
OP_0 OP_PUSHBYTES_20 d3d34b3e9c9951879111c29022a9743a9b91eb0c
address
bc1q60f5k05un9gc0yg3c2gz92t582der6cvmm23fv
transaction
86cdf91ec79c820b7a3e41988c01507591509e9c835472245a96fc9ed428943c